Best way to avoid repeating expressions. 3. ... Forcing latex to write equations on one line. Hot Network Questions Web10 apr. 2024 · Go to Formulas > Define Name to open the New Name dialog. Enter “ISPRIME” in Name, “Input a number to determine whther it is prime” in Comment, and the Lambda formula in Refers To. Click OK to create the function. We can open the Name Manager (Ctrl+F3) to see this and any other custom functions in the workbook.
